Handover: Marrow ORM refactor

Hey Tovi — wrapping up my piece of the Marrow layer before I'm out. The old query builder in Brindlecart is gone; everything now routes through the new mapper, and the shadow-write comparison has been clean for six days. Still todo: the batch-delete path and the reporting replicas, which lag on long transactions. Don't touch the session pool sizing until the replicas are migrated or you'll see deadlocks again. For the sync, note that staging currently runs with these values:

config for fahip-yaweg:
[rusax]
port = 9090
team = gormir
host = rusax.orvexio.corp
region = outer-4
access_code = ac_9be542
timeout_ms = 1500

HANDOVER NOTE — Finance Directorate

To the incoming director: the Q3 cash-flow forecast for Ostrane Holdings is complete and reconciled against the Kelwick plant figures. Receivables from the Brannor contract remain the main variable; assume a two-week lag. Marta Quill can walk you through the model. One item could not go into the shared file and is appended below.

management briefing: The renewal with Quenaelox Group closes at $2 million a year, 15 percent below the last contract. Project Holwyn slips by six weeks because of the tooling delay.

MEMO — Veltrane Systems, Receiving, Dorsey Point site

Six Quillax M4 demo units are being returned from the Harwick trade floor. All were powered down and factory-reset by the field team; do not re-image before intake inspection. Log serial plates against the loan sheet and flag any missing styli. Cartons are marked DEMO RETURN in orange. Expected arrival Thursday morning via courier. Storage bay 3 is reserved. The confidential hand-over instruction for the courier follows below.

courier memo of kagug-yajof: the belys wenok courier leaves the praix ledger at gate 8902 under passcode 669584